About the Forum
This special Waves of Change Forum edition is co-hosted and backed by the French Government via its Ministry for the Ecological Transition and Open Innovation Lab ‘Ecolab‘ together with the Coalition for Sustainable AI and our steering committee has been joined officially by the Directorate General for Maritime Affairs, Fisheries and Aquaculture (DGAMPA).
The Forum is labelled as part of the French Presidency of the G7 highlighting its contribution to international priorities on climate resilience, sustainable innovation and the mobilisation of AI for the ecological transition. It builds on the momentum of UNOC-3 in Nice and the launch of the AI & Ocean vertical of the Sustainable AI Coalition by the French Government, UN environment Programme, and the UN agency for Digital Technologies.
The Forum will bring together coastal cities, public decision-makers, international organisations, researchers, startups, SMEs and major technology and maritime stakeholders to explore how artificial intelligence can concretely support ocean protection and coastal resilience.
